    <description>The Tribunal held that the Assessing Officer failed to disprove the genuineness of transactions involving share application money received by the assessee, leading to the dismissal of the penalty imposed under section 271(1)(c) for unexplained cash credit. The burden of proving the source of the money largely fell on the Assessing Officer, who did not adequately verify the depositors&#039; existence or financial capacity. The Tribunal emphasized the necessity of thorough inquiries before treating cash credits as income, ultimately upholding the assessee&#039;s position and dismissing the appeal.</description>
